Walking towards a Brighter Tomorrow Footwear Distribution at Sonbhadra.
We recently organized a footwear distribution drive at Sonbhadra, Uttar Pradesh for children comfort and safety. Where more than 80 children were gifted new footwear to ensure their comfort, safety, and well-being. In many rural areas, children walk long distances to school and play without proper footwear, which can cause injuries and discomfort. Empowering Girls Through Menstrual Health Education at Assam.
Under Project Laadli, we conducted a Menstrupedia Comic Distribution and Self-Care Awareness Session at Mahendra Das Vidyapith School, Nagaon, Assam. More than 50 girls joined the session. We spoke about menstrual health, self-care, and hygiene in a simple and comfortable way. Each girl received a Menstrupedia comic to help her understand menstruation easily and without fear. These comics help remove fear and confusion and guide girls to care for their bodies with confidence.
